Title :
Design of Nyquist and near-Nyquist pulses with spectral constraints

Abstract :
Two design procedures, one based on switched pulse shapes, and the other based on alternating projections in the time and frequency domain, are used to obtain interference and jitter-free or reduced interference and jitter (near-Nyquist) pulse-shaping filters. The latter method, that incorporates both frequency- and time- domain constraints into the linear filter design procedure, allows common pulse-shaping filters to be used for both QPSK and 8-PSK used in contemporary satellite modems
